How to remove torque converter clutch?
Okay I feel stupid, but gotta ask in order to know the answer
Is there a trick to removing the 6 bolts that hold the torque converter clutch in the transmission? Need to remove transmission from the engine and these 6 bolts don't want to budge at all. Any tricks or hints? Or do I just need to hit it with a ton of PB Blaster and use a really big breaker bar? No compressor tools unfortunately

Use a screwdriver or somthing to hold the torqueconverter is place while you pull on the wrench. you can slide it into the holes in the flex-plate and turn it untill it stops aginst the dust cover.
